Hello,
I am trying the 1.10.3.4 alpha linux version.
There are some missing directories in the compressed file, blocking the fresh install from working.
In order to a fresh install work, you need to:
cd ~/games/SecondLife_1_10_3_4
mkdir -p SecondLife/cache
mkdir -p SecondLife/user_settings
Then, calling the game will work:
~/games/SecondLife_1_10_3_4/secondlife

Tested on Debian GNU / Linux 3.1 Sarge, maintained up to date with security fixes.

That's not an SL bug, it's a bug in the tool you used to extract the archive. If you use the command-line tar utility, those directories are included. Some other file-rolling utilities ignore them because they're empty.

Hello,

I just tried the current Linux client on Ubuntu 6.06 (Dapper) (arch. x86, kernel 686). My PC: Intel Celeron D 336 2.8Ghz, 512MB Ram, Geforce FX5200 128MB ... current nvidia driver from the repos ... WindowManager: XFCE4.4 (with GNOME-support)


FIRST TO SAY: The Linux client runs MUCH faster than the windows client and has significantly LESS lag inside the game ... so, congratulations and keep on the good work!


Some things I noticed:

- The libdb-4.2.so that is needed in order to run the client is NOT installed by default (because Dapper already uses the 4.3 version) ... So all Dapper-users should do a "sudo apt-get install libdb-4.2" before running secondlife binary ...

- If extracted with file-roller, some folders are missing and need to be created manually (as mentioned in a post above) ... I know this is a bug of the Extraction-Software, but maybe two empty (hidden) files inside those folders would solve the problem and make things easier for the average User to install

- Some keys collide with common window-manager hotkeys on Linux (like Alt, which is often used to drag the window) and moving the cursor inside text-inputs is not possible with the arrow-keys ...

- The game repeatedly outputs something like "failed to set locale EN.US-8859-1" (I dont exactly remember) on the console ... I am using a german locale, but ubuntu should install a lot of locales by default (but maybe this is not really a bug, but due to a misconfiguration) ...


but apart from this, this is the most stable "alpha"-version of a piece of software, I've ever seen
